📍 Local Knowledge
Old Man’s at Tourmaline in San Diego County—also known simply as “Tourmaline Surf Park” or “Old Man’s”—is an exposed reef-to-sandbreak that’s famous for its mellow, longboard‑friendly waves and high beginner appeal. It works year‑round, though it truly shines in winter when west‑northwest swells meet offshore winds from the east or northeast. Popular and often crowded—especially with longboarders—Old Man’s draws a friendly mix of intermediate riders and learners. Hazards include occasional crowds, submerged rocks in the reef zone, and localism in the lineup. Winter, and notably January, usually offer the most consistent, clean surf.
